Output 07d0842a017012ef28d57059ab93772691759f4b9807210f4c479bacad6af45e:69

value
74950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be89f27e76adc8576fa11917e74b8864c2c1860 OP_EQUAL
address
379nThcRS2BxxcVykVQadst3X8E3J8s8mD
transaction
07d0842a017012ef28d57059ab93772691759f4b9807210f4c479bacad6af45e
spent
true